Multipath Routing Protocol Based on Source Routing
-
摘要: 为了进一步有效地利用网络资源,采用多路径机制改善最佳链路状态路由协议OLSR的网络性能,提出了基于源路由的多路径SR-MPOLSR协议.首先利用MPR多点中继机制高效获取网络的拓扑图,并在网络节点中用多重Dijkstra算法计算出多路径,然后采用加权分配的循环调度实现负载分配,最后引入源路由机制完成报文的选径转发.这种SR-MPOLSR协议较之OLSR协议可进一步利用网络资源,改善链路的吞吐量和平均延迟,增加网络健壮性和可靠性.仿真结果显示,与OLSR算法相比,SR-MPOLSR算法的数据传输率提高20%~40%,端对端平均延迟降低10%~30%.Abstract: To further effectively utilize network resources,the multipath mechanism was used to improve the network performance of OLSR (optimized link state routing),and a source routing-based SR-MPOLSR (source routing-multipath OLSR) protocol was proposed.In this protocol,MPRs (multipoint relays) are used to obtain the network topology effectively,and then the multiple Dijkstra algorithm is operated in nodes to calculate the routes and allocate the loads by the weighted round-robin.Finally,the source routing mechanism is adopted to retransmit data packets.The SR-MPOLSR can utilize the network resources ulteriorly,improve the throughput and average delay of chains,and increase the network robustness and dependability.The simulation result shows that compared with the OLSR,data deliver ratio for the SR-MPOLSR increases by 20% to 40%,and end-end delay reduces by 10% to 30%.
点击查看大图
计量
- 文章访问数: 1318
- HTML全文浏览量: 56
- PDF下载量: 509
- 被引次数: 0